Reflection after lessons.

Students couldnt keep up and benefit. I feel that they are trying, just that some get stuck.

1. They dun understand the question
2. They cant analyse the situation, ie what they can do next
3. Some werent really trying. But some were hearteningly improving on effort

I need to guide them through the first point, because:
-we want to test them for what to do given a question, content-wise. they should not be handicapped by anything else.
-They need specific practice that can give them the confidence and the affirmation of their skill level
-They need confidence to try unseen problems.

Therefore i cannot keep testing them using familiar models. In fact I should always be testing them on unfamiliar models. But then first they must be strong enough on the first point of understanding complex questions.

So point 1: build up on individual comprehension skills
point 2: build up on individual analysis skills, incorporating exam strategies
point 3: test them using unseen problems, but structure the problems so that they test one concept at a time.
point 4: encourage them at all times. teach them positive attitude. teach them preparatory skills.
